Semi-Supervised Bayesian Mixture Models Incorporating Batch Correction


[Up] [Top]

Documentation for package ‘batchmix’ version 2.2.0

Help Pages

batchmix-package Bayesian Mixture Modelling for Joint Model-Based Clustering/Classification and Batch Correction
batchmix Bayesian Mixture Modelling for Joint Model-Based Clustering/Classification and Batch Correction
batchmix, Bayesian Mixture Modelling for Joint Model-Based Clustering/Classification and Batch Correction
BatchMixtureModel Bayesian Mixture Modelling for Joint Model-Based Clustering/Classification and Batch Correction
batchSemiSupervisedMixtureModel Batch semisupervised mixture model
calcAllocProb Calculate allocation probabilities
checkDataGenerationInputs Check data generation inputs
checkProposalWindows Check proposal windows
collectAcceptanceRates Collect acceptance rate
continueChain Continue chain
continueChains Continue chains
createSimilarityMat Create Similarity Matrix
gammaLogLikelihood Gamma log-likelihood
generateBatchData Generate batch data
generateBatchDataLogPoisson Generate batch data
generateBatchDataMVT Generate batch data from a multivariate t distribution
generateBatchDataVaryingRepresentation Generate batch data
generateGroupIDsInSimulator Generate group IDs
generateInitialLabels Generate initial labels
getLikelihood Get likelihood
getSampledBatchScale Get sampled batch shift
getSampledBatchShift Get sampled batch shift
getSampledClusterMeans Get sampled cluster means
invGammaLogLikelihood Inverse gamma log-likelihood
invWishartLogLikelihood Inverse-Wishart log-likelihood
minVI Minimium VI
plotAcceptanceRates Plot acceptance rates
plotLikelihoods Plot likelihoods
plotSampledBatchMeans Plot sampled batch means
plotSampledBatchScales Plot sampled batch scales
plotSampledClusterMeans Plot sampled cluster means
plotSampledParameter Plot sampled vector parameter
predictClass Predict class
predictFromMultipleChains Predict from multiple MCMC chains
prepareInitialParameters Prepare initial values
processMCMCChain Process MCMC chain
processMCMCChains Process MCMC chains
rStickBreakingPrior Random Draw From Stick Breaking Prior
runBatchMix Run Batch Mixture Model
runMCMCChains Run MCMC Chains
sampleMVN Sample mixture of multivariate normal distributions with batch effects
sampleMVT Sample mixture of multivariate t-distributions with batch effects
samplePriorLabels Sample prior labels
sampleSemisupervisedMVN Sample semi-supervised MVN Mixture model
sampleSemisupervisedMVT Sample semi-supervised MVT Mixture model
VI.lb Minimum VI lower bound
wishartLogLikelihood Wishart log-likelihood